Kothapalle is a village situated in Rajavommangi mandal of East Godavari district in Andhra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 50 families residing in the village Kothapalle. The total population of Kothapalle is 176 out of which 91 are males and 85 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Kothapalle is 934.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Kothapalle village is 20 which is 11% of the total population. There are 9 male children and 11 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Kothapalle is 1,222 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(934) of Kothapalle village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Kothapalle is 27.6%. Thus Kothapalle village has a lower literacy rate compared to 63.8% of East Godavari district. The male literacy rate is 21.95% and the female literacy rate is 33.78% in Kothapalle village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 98.3% of total population in Kothapalle village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Kothapalle village out of total population, 144 were engaged in work activities. 98.6%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 1.4%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 144 workers engaged in Main Work, 0 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 138 were Agricultural labourers.
